It's a tie for me with Chase and Reed. If Chase played last year, I think he'd be #1.
After that, I'd go Clayton, then Landry -- both superb all-around players -- receiving, blocking, and on ST.
The more recent guys often get favored. For instance, people remember Landry as a ST headhunter, but some forget how good Clayton was on ST. They both played 3 years. Landry finished with 21 tackles, which is impressive. Clayton finished with 36 (4 as a Safety vs. Texas in the Cotton Bowl).
